Phlebotomy as a healthcare specialty involves drawing blood samples for laboratory testing, transfusion, donation, and various other medical purposes. The work requires technical skill in venipuncture (drawing blood from veins) and capillary collection (finger sticks), along with patient interaction, sample handling, and various safety practices. Phlebotomy technicians work in hospitals, clinical laboratories, blood donation centers, doctor's offices, and various other healthcare settings. The Bureau of Labor Statistics projects strong continued employment growth for phlebotomy positions through 2032, making phlebotomy certification an attractive credential for healthcare career entry.

The major phlebotomy certifications each have associated certification examinations that practice tests prepare for. The Certified Phlebotomy Technician (CPT) credential from National Healthcareer Association (NHA) is one of the most widely recognized โ a 100-question exam covering safety, patient prep, blood collection procedures, processing, and regulatory issues. The Phlebotomy Technician (PBT) certification from American Society for Clinical Pathology (ASCP) requires a more rigorous education and experience pathway with comprehensive examination. The CPT from National Center for Competency Testing (NCCT) and Registered Phlebotomy Technician (RPT) from American Medical Technologists (AMT) are additional widely-accepted credentials with their own specific examinations.

Effective use of phlebotomy practice tests follows several patterns that maximize preparation efficiency. Take initial practice test early in your preparation to assess baseline knowledge โ most students score 50-65% on first attempts, identifying substantial knowledge gaps to address through focused study.
Review every question (correct and incorrect) carefully โ understanding why each answer is correct or incorrect builds knowledge that transfers to similar but different questions on the actual exam. Track topic-level performance to identify weak areas. Spend additional study time on identified weak areas. Retake practice tests after focused study to verify improvement. Aim for consistent 80%+ scores before scheduling actual certification examination.

For users wanting to identify their weak areas through practice tests, systematic approach helps. Take a full practice test under timed conditions. Score the test and note overall percentage. Group questions by content area (anatomy, venipuncture, order of draw, etc.). Calculate percentage correct in each content area.
Identify any area where you're below 75% as priority for additional study. Some practice test platforms automatically generate this analysis; for others you may need to track manually. The systematic approach prevents the common error of just retaking tests without focused study, which produces little improvement compared to targeted study based on identified weak areas.

Specific phlebotomy procedures that consistently appear on examinations warrant particular study attention. Order of draw โ the specific sequence of tube colors when drawing multiple tubes (typically: blood culture, light blue citrate, gold/red SST, green heparin, lavender EDTA, gray sodium fluoride). Venipuncture site selection โ preferred veins (median cubital, cephalic, basilic), avoiding sites with IVs, hematomas, or scars. Patient identification โ three identifiers minimum verification before drawing. Tube additives and their purposes for specific tests. Each high-yield topic appears repeatedly on certification examinations because of its clinical importance for accurate test results and patient safety in actual practice settings.

For users dealing with the variability across phlebotomy work settings, several patterns help understanding. Hospital phlebotomy involves diverse patient populations, complex collections, and integration with broader hospital workflows. Commercial laboratory work involves higher volume routine collections in production-oriented environment. Blood donation centers focus exclusively on volunteer donor collections with different equipment and procedures. Doctor's offices and clinics involve smaller volumes with more patient interaction time per draw. Mobile phlebotomy serves patients unable to travel to facilities. Each setting suits different practitioner preferences regarding pace, patient interaction, and work environment.
For users interested in donor phlebotomy specifically (blood donations rather than diagnostic collections), specialty considerations apply. Donor phlebotomy uses larger needles for higher volume collections (typically 16-gauge versus 21-gauge for diagnostic). Donor sessions take longer (typically 8-10 minutes for whole blood donation). Patient interaction includes screening for donor eligibility, education about donation process, and post-donation care. American Red Cross and other blood collection organizations have specialty training programs for donor phlebotomists. The work is typically more positively framed (helping donors save lives through volunteer donations) than diagnostic phlebotomy on patients with health concerns.
